Have to disagree with Robruf on the Enzo vid though :roll: In fact I quite liked the Motorweek coverage. Surely it hasn't got the magic of Tiff exploding from your screen but it's nicely put together.
TopGear has, unfortunately, a made herself a bad name among supercar manufacturers :cry: So I think this is the way TopGear has to go when they want to be able to continue to review modern supercars on television.
> Clarkie as anchorman, not as a driver
> Accomplished drivers like e.g. Damon Hill puting the exotic cars through their paces
> Mentioning and thanking the private owner of the car
